Apple Touts A11 Bionic Chip in New ‘Unleash’ iPhone X ad

Following a humorous new Face ID ad earlier this month, Apple today continues its iPhone X advertising push. The company has debuted a new 1-minute ad that highlights the A11 Bionic processor…


Apple is calling the new ad ‘Unleash,’ touting that the iPhone X allows you to “unleash a more powerful you” thanks to the A11 Bionic chip inside.



Throughout the ad, an iPhone X user can be seen walking through the street playing the game Vainglory 5V5 on his device. Suddenly, the game takes over the real-world with the iPhone X user seemingly empowered by the A11 Bionic chip to continue competing and using his iPhone X: Unleash a more powerful you. A11 Bionic chip on iPhone X.


Today’s ad is just the latest in Apple’s iPhone X marketing push. Earlier this month, the company showcased the device’s Face ID functionality in a humorous game show-themed ad. Other ads have highlighted the camera, Apple Pay, and much more.
